Watch Oz no Mahoutsukai (1986) episode 51 English Subbed

Oz no Mahoutsukai (1986) episode 51 stream online hd free

The Wonderful Wizard of Oz, The Wizard of Oz, オズの魔法使い ep 51

Press ESC to close